What is ProWrite?

ProWrite, developed by CEI, is a weld procedure software designed to simplify the creation and storage of welding documentation such as PQR, WPS, WPQ, and Welders Continuity records. According to the vendor, ProWrite is suitable for businesses of all sizes, ranging from small enterprises to large corporations. It caters to welding professionals, quality control personnel, engineering and construction companies, manufacturing and fabrication industries, as well as the oil and gas sector.

Key Features

Simple Interface: ProWrite offers a user-friendly interface that allows users to easily create single or multi-process documents. According to the vendor, the intuitive design ensures efficient navigation and utilization of the software.

Easy Report Creation: ProWrite provides built-in reports for various purposes, including Continuity, Welder Certification Expirations, Inspection Defects, PQR's, and WPS's. Users can also import customized reports, allowing for flexibility in generating necessary documentation.

Code Assistance: ProWrite offers code assistance features that save time and ensure compliance when creating ASME Section IX and AWS D1.1 documents. According to the vendor, the software provides guidance and prompts based on relevant code requirements, reducing errors and ensuring adherence to industry standards.

Integrated Documents Interface: With ProWrite's integrated document database, users can quickly create a Welding Procedure Specification (WPS) directly from a Procedure Qualification Record (PQR). Similarly, users can create a Welder Performance Qualification (WPQ) directly from a PQR, WPS, or WPS template, streamlining the document creation process.

Cost Effective: ProWrite helps users save time and money by offering fast document and continuity creation. The software provides a storage solution and quick searching capabilities, keeping documents organized and easily accessible.

Material Databases: ProWrite includes built-in databases for Base Metals, Filler Metals, Gases, Pipes/Tubes, and Joint Images, ensuring compliance with code book requirements. According to the vendor, these databases provide users with a comprehensive and up-to-date resource for selecting appropriate materials for welding projects.

ProWrite Code Compliance: ProWrite ensures users can focus on their work without being slowed down by code compliance issues. The software supports code compliance for ASME Section IX with Section I, III, VIII, B31.1 & B31.3, as well as AWS D1.1, providing confidence in documentation, processes, and certifications.

Cloud-Based and On-Premise Services: ProWrite offers both cloud-based and on-premise versions of the software, allowing users to choose the deployment option that best suits their needs. According to the vendor, this flexibility enables efficient utilization of the software.

Single and Multi-User Versions: ProWrite caters to the needs of different users and organizations by offering both single and multi-user versions of the software. According to the vendor, this allows for collaboration and concurrent usage, ensuring seamless teamwork on welding projects.

Notifications: ProWrite provides notifications to keep users informed about important updates, such as welder certification expirations. According to the vendor, these notifications help users stay on top of their documentation and ensure timely actions are taken.
